Transaction 88811811196f5cad3147667b6e80d9a3527e34597df6f0528c356e41fd584afd
1 Input
1 Output
-
88811811196f5cad3147667b6e80d9a3527e34597df6f0528c356e41fd584afd:0
- value
- 76169
- script pubkey
- OP_0 OP_PUSHBYTES_32 1dc0446092c38dccca17332d99533fdf7b2c4dea1b5f30975ed4cc7a77221a63
- address
- bc1qrhqygcyjcwxuejshxvkej5elmaajcn02rd0np9676nx85aezrf3su32238